George and Amal Clooney are officially parents. The power couple welcomed twins Ella and Alexander Clooney into the world Tuesday morning, USA Today reports. "Ella, Alexander, and Amal are all healthy, happy, and doing fine," the family's publicist said in an email. "George is sedated and should recover in a few days."
Actor George Clooney, 56, married international human rights lawyer Amal Clooney, 39, in 2014. The parents had reportedly chosen not to learn their babies' sexes prior to delivery: "I don’t know where this rumor comes from that we're going to have a boy and a girl," George Clooney had said in February. "We ourselves don't know yet and don't want to know."
Ella and Alexander won't be the only new twins in the celeb-o-sphere for long. Beyoncé and her husband, Jay Z, are expecting twins likely sometime in the early summer.
